The salary statistics and trend of database administrators in the industry of agencies, brokerages, and other insurance related activities are shown in the following tables and chart. |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
|---|---|
| 10th Percentile Wage | $48,820 |
| 25th Percentile Wage | $64,510 |
| 50th Percentile Wage | $88,840 |
| 75th Percentile Wage | $114,720 |
| 90th Percentile Wage | $133,540 |
Table 1 shows the average annual salaries for database administrators in the industry of agencies, brokerages, and other insurance related activities. The salaries are shown in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) database administrators is $133,540. The median annual salary (50th percentile) is $88,840.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ent database administrators is $48,820.
The table and chart below show the trend of the median salary of database administrators in the industry of Agencies, Brokerages, and Other Insurance Related Activities from 2012 to 2017.
| Year | Median Salary | Yearly Growth | 5-Year Growth |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2017 | $88,840 | 6.31% | 17.04% |
| 2016 | $83,230 | 2.58% | - |
| 2015 | $81,080 | 1.33% | - |
| 2014 | $80,000 | 3.51% | - |
| 2013 | $77,190 | 4.52% | - |
| 2012 | $73,700 | - | - |
